Paycom Software (NYSE:PAYC - Get Free Report) had its price target lifted by stock analysts at Cantor Fitzgerald from $135.00 to $195.00 in a report issued on Thursday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has a "neutral" rating on the software maker's stock. Cantor Fitzgerald's price objective indicates a potential upside of 11.44% from the company's previous close.

Paycom Software (NYSE:PAYC -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 5th. The software maker reported $2.78 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.38 by $0.40. Paycom Software had a return on equity of 28.34% and a net margin of 22.44%.The firm had revenue of $531.20 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$513.12 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$2.06 EPS. Paycom Software's revenue for the quarter was up 9.8%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, sell-side analysts expect that Paycom Software will post 9.37 earnings per share for the current year.

Paycom Software, Inc NYSE: PAYC is a cloud-based human capital management (HCM) software provider that delivers an end-to-end solution for human resources, payroll, talent acquisition, time and labor management, and talent management. Its single-database platform enables organizations to process payroll, track time, administer benefits, and manage recruiting and employee development through a unified system. Paycom's software is designed to streamline administrative tasks, improve data accuracy, and provide real-time reporting and analytics to support strategic HR decisions.
The company's core offerings include payroll processing with built-in tax compliance, employee self-service functionality, automated time tracking, and customizable talent acquisition tools that allow employers to create and post job requisitions, screen candidates, and conduct onboarding electronically.
